Description

Focusing his writing on the Papal church and taking a direct Biblical approach, Calvin wrote this magnum opus to lay out what it means to be a Christian and also the core beliefs that every believer should hold on to. Although the contents in this book have been debated hotly for many centuries, the fact remains that without this text we would not have the diversity that exists within the church today. Many other Protestant writers wrote their own theology texts to counter the claims about scripture that Calvin wrote about in here. Now in larger print!
